God has provided man with a set of blueprints... the Holy Bible. (Heb 8:5 & 1 Cor 3:10-11) They are the pattern of doctrine and worship for the church. But are the blueprints complete? Did God provide a complete set of blueprints or are we left to guess? Is the Bible complete enough to be considered an all sufficient guide? Jesus made this promise to the apostles in Jn 16:13, "But when He, the Spirit of truth, comes, He will guide you into all the truth". The apostles were inspired directly by the Holy Spirit and thus we have all the truth in the New Testament. This fulfills the very promise that Jesus made to them. Isn't it great to know that we have a permanent written unchangeable record of all the truth in the pages of the Bible. The last book of the Bible to be written was Revelation in about 96 AD. Since that time nothing has been added to the Bible. The Bible then became a complete set of blueprints for man to build the church and home from. Although many modern skeptics are ... ...

The Hebrew version is extant as two psalms, labeled 151A and 151B, though most of B is damaged. This scroll includes other Psalms that were similarly excluded from later Christian canons and the Hebrew Bible canon, but may have held liturgical significance in the Second Temple period and after. Psalm 151 is included in the Greek Septuagint as represented by all three major early biblical codices, Codex Sinaiticus, Codex Vaticanus, and Codex ... The psalm is significant, because it reflects the developing role of David in Second Temple Judaism (515 BCE-70 CE) as the founder of temple worship and writer of hymns, as the anointed of God, and even as an inspired "prophet," since the psalms attributed to him became ... ...
